When a consumer applies to open a new bank account, the bank employee takes down information about the consumer. 80% of banks send the information a bank account screening agency, usually either Chex Systems or Early Warning Services (owned by Bank of America, Chase, Capital One, and Wells Fargo). The United States has what is referred to as a “dual banking system,” in which banks can choose to apply for a charter from a state banking authority or a federal charter from the Office of the Comptroller of the Currency (OCC), a bureau within the Department of the Treasury. [read post]
